Is Amd Radeon Graphics Good For Gaming?

AMD Radeon graphics are a popular choice for gamers, and with good reason. They offer good performance at a reasonable price, making them a great option for budget-conscious gamers. However, there are pros and cons to using AMD Radeon graphics, and it’s important to know what they are before making a decision.

One of the biggest advantages of AMD Radeon graphics is that they offer good performance for the price. This means that you can get good gaming performance without having to spend a lot of money. However, there are also some disadvantages to using AMD Radeon graphics.

One disadvantage is that AMD Radeon graphics aren‘t as powerful or advanced as some of the more expensive graphics options. This means that you may not be able to get the same level of performance or image quality that you would with more expensive graphics options.

Another disadvantage is that AMD Radeon graphics can be less stable than some of the more expensive options. This means that you may experience more crashes or glitches than you would with more expensive graphics options.

Overall, AMD Radeon graphics are a good choice for budget-conscious gamers who are looking for good performance at a reasonable price. However, if you’re looking for the absolute best performance or image quality, you may want to consider other options.

How Does Amd Ryzen Compare To Intel In Gaming Laptops?

AMD Ryzen processors have gained popularity in recent years due to their impressive performance and affordability. However, many people are still unsure about how these processors compare to Intel’s offerings when it comes to gaming laptops.

One area where AMD Ryzen processors excel is multitasking. Their multithreading capabilities allow them to handle multiple tasks simultaneously, making them ideal for users who frequently run multiple applications or games at once.

On the other hand, Intel processors are known for their excellent single-core performance, which can be beneficial for certain games that require high frame rates. However, this advantage may not be as important as it once was, as many modern games are designed to take advantage of multiple cores.

In terms of power consumption, AMD Ryzen processors tend to consume less power than Intel processors, making them more efficient and resulting in longer battery life. This can be particularly beneficial for gaming laptops, as users often want to be able to play for extended periods of time without being tethered to a power outlet.

Overall, the choice between AMD Ryzen and Intel processors will depend on your specific needs and preferences. If you’re looking for a laptop that can handle multitasking and long gaming sessions, AMD Ryzen processors may be the better choice. On the other hand, if you prefer high frame rates and single-core performance, Intel processors may be the better option.

How Does Amd Ryzen Compare To Intel In Gaming Performance Per Dollar?

AMD Ryzen processors have consistently been praised for their performance and value, especially in terms of gaming. They offer good gaming performance per dollar, compared to Intel processors.

Ryzen processors are known for their high core and thread counts, which allow them to handle multiple tasks simultaneously. This makes them well-suited for gaming, as they can handle resource-intensive games without slowing down.

In terms of gaming performance per dollar, Ryzen processors tend to offer better value than Intel processors. For example, the Ryzen 5 3600X offers comparable gaming performance to the Intel Core i7-9700K, but at a lower price point.
